From Vatican Avenue/Vatican Museums to PP2 by bus and metro
To get from Vatican Avenue/Vatican Museums to PP2 in Rome, take the A metro from Cipro station to Anagnina station. Next, take the 20 bus from Anagnina Metro station to Sorbona station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 3 min. The ride fare is €1.50. The bus and metro schedule from Vatican Avenue/Vatican Museums may change.
